CELEBRATING HINDI DIWAS AT EFS

“हिंदी मेरा ईमान है, हिंदी मेरी पहचान है।
हिंदी हूँ मैं, वतन भी मेरा प्यारा हिंदुस्तान है।“

These words rightly express the love for Hindi language in the country. Hindi Diwas is officially observed on the 14th of September across India. To mark the day, the tiny tots of EFS celebrated the day in their unique ways. 

Students put forward endearing performances to highlight the richness of Hindi Language. Dressed as Rani Laxmibai, a student very expressively recited a Hindi poetry titled, ‘Jhansi Wali Rani’. Dressed up as mouse and elephant, students recited fun poems based on the animals. Through recitations coupled with actions, the little ones elevated the experience of enjoying Hindi poetry. It not only brought them closer to their love for Hindi language and culture, but it also built their interest for the language. The celebration of Hindi Diwas was a wonderful way to familiarize students with the beauty of Hindi language and its wide range of poetry.
